The circa 1925 building was completely renovated inside and out, returning it to its former glory.
In the entry, a vintage chandelier from 1stdibs is complemented by a floor of dark gray Pietra marble. Rustic bench is from the Perish Trust.
The feather headdress above the table was purchased to balance the industrial materials and hard lines of the custom console. Blue vases are through Flora Grubb.
In the dining room, a framed Scottish Highland Cow offers a humorous counterpoint to an elegant Abigail Ahern chandelier and dining chairs sporting an Osborne & Little fabric. Moroccan wool rug is from Ebanista.
Living room walls in Benjamin Moore’s Boothbay Gray set the stage for a Schumacher teal velvet-swathed sofa, while a custom Lindstrom rug complements brass chairs covered in a tonal, geometric Mary McDonald for Schumacher print. Gray armchairs are through ABC Carpet & Home. Nobilis sheers are through Kneedler | Fauchère.
Living room chairs and sofa face off across a Jax coffee table from Grey Furniture. The Louise LeBourgeois painting above the fireplace is through Dolby Chadwick Gallery. Tall cabinets flanking the fireplace are wrapped in ostrich leather with brass and blackened wood details.
In the breakfast nook, a Roll & Hill chandelier and Kartell chairs are from Design Within Reach.
A trio of Jason Koharik Geo glass pendants from Lawson Fenning and Cherner stools from Design Within Reach add modern notes to the kitchen. Backsplash tile is from Heath Ceramics.
A custom desk with a Jonathan Adler chair is a perfect fit in a corner of the master suite; circular Adnet mirror is from Design Within Reach.
Drapes are in a Cowtan & Tout fabric; Marset pendant lights are through YLighting.
A Hydro Systems tub is tucked into the master bathroom under a vintage chandelier from 1stdibs; Jim Thompson window shade fabric is from Shears & Window.
